What is a Car Key Locksmith?
A car key locksmith is a specialized expert trained in managing a wide variety of car key and lock-related problems. Unlike conventional locksmiths who work on residential or commercial locks, car key locksmiths focus on vehicle-related jobs. Their skillset enables them to work with modern-day electronic key systems, traditional metal keys, and even innovative keyless entry systems.

Types of Car Key Services Offered by Locksmiths
Modern locksmith professionals are geared up with tools and technology to handle a wide array of key-related services. Here's a more detailed take a look at their key locations of competence:
1. Standard Key Cutting
For older cars or those using metal keys, locksmith professionals can replicate or replace keys utilizing precision cutting tools.
2. Transponder Key Programming
Transponder keys have a chip that communicates with your car's onboard computer to start the engine. If this chip is harmed or lost, a locksmith can program new keys to match your car.
3. Proximity and Keyless Entry Systems
Distance keys and keyless entry systems are ending up being increasingly common, specifically in modern vehicles. A locksmith can repair, reprogram, or replace these innovative systems.
4. Smart Key Repair or Replacement
Smart keys, which permit you to unlock, start, and manage your car from another location, can develop technical issues. Specialized locksmiths can replace or reprogram these innovative keys.
5. Ignition Repair
When your car's ignition cylinder triggers problems, such as a key being stuck or refusing to turn, a locksmith can repair or replace the system.

FAQs About Locksmith Car Key Services
1. How much does it cost to replace a car key?
The cost of replacing a car key differs depending on the key type. Standard metal keys are normally more economical than transponder or wise keys, which require programming. Prices generally range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 300 however can be greater for high-end vehicles.
2. Can a locksmith make a key without the original?
Yes. A proficient locksmith can produce a brand-new key even if you do not have the original by using the car's VIN number and other technical approaches.
3. Are locksmith services for cars covered by insurance?
In most cases, car insurance may cover locksmith services, specifically for emergency situations. Contact your provider to learn if it's included in your policy.
4. For how long does it require to replace a car key?
The time required depends upon the key type. A traditional key might take just a couple of minutes, while transponder and clever keys might use up to an hour due to programming needs.
5. What should I do if my key breaks in the ignition?
If your key breaks in the ignition, prevent trying to eliminate it yourself since this might cause more damage. Call a locksmith who can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the ignition as required.
